I am the 2nd owner of this 1999 Porsche 911 Carrera 4 which is also know by the Porsche internal code of 996. The 1999 C4 featured several firsts for the 911.  In addition to the water cooled engine the car has Porsche Stability Management (PSM), which is the Porsche version of traction control, and E-gas.  With all wheel drive and the PMS this car just grips the road without being tail happy like earlier versions of the car.

I have owned the car for 8 years and over that time I have made a few upgrades that improve the car but keep the stock look.  The upgrades include:

LN IMS bearing:  this is a must.   Do not buy a 911 or Boxster without having this done.  Almost all Porsche Techs recommend that this upgrade be done.

Transmission reconditioned: I had my local shop open the transmission and check for wear and had them replace the pinion bearings.

ROW030 suspension:  This is a Porsche suspension package that improves handling without being harsh and lowers the car by about 1/2 inch.

Short shifter

Upgraded exhaust: adding a few HP and more pleasing and aggressive exhaust note.

Clear side marker lights, CD holder delete

The wear items on the car are all newer.  The clutch was changed 10K miles ago, Porsche rotors are new, the 17" tires (HTZ III) are new.  The car also has the better filtering spin on oil filter and adapter and a low temperature thermostat. 

Over the time I have owned the car I averaged 4000 miles per year and stored the car during the winter.  I am selling the car because a recent move has left me short on garage space.

Also included in the sale are a set of original 18" turbo twist wheels and heated winter storage in the Holland, MI area.

 

These cars are a blast to drive and surprisingly modern for the age:  0-60 in 5ish seconds and 173 mph top speed, air bags, antilock brakes, traction control, etc.

 

The car is clean and in good condition. There are a few stone chips on the hood, a small dent near the drivers side marker light, and a few other dings.  Overall for the age and mileage the car is clean.  The interior is clean, the drivers seat shows a bit of wear but not rips or tears.  There is some spotting on the passenger side headlight and a small chip on the windshield.  The paint is good but there are a few spots that have crazing.  If you were looking at the car you would not think anything of them as they are that small.

Here are this year's top 5 automaker April Fools’ jokes

Mon, Apr 2 2018

April 1 is the wonderful day when PR departments really push themselves to top the zany jokes they came up with the previous year. And it's not just fast-food chains competing with each other, or breweries announcing they have released stuff like a fermented herring flavored beer: carmakers' media teams rarely miss out on the opportunity to play a little joke on their audience. Here are a few of our favorites from this year:1) Porsche Porsche announced that it's launching a Mission E tractor, styled to resemble its 1950s tractor models. "With a power output in excess of 700hp, the Mission E Tractor will be the fastest accelerating agricultural vehicle in the world, enabling farmers to harvest crops in record time with the added environmental benefits of zero emissions at source and significantly reduced operating noise."2) Lexus Lexus actually jumped the gun, telling us on March 28 that it's combining cars and drivers using DNA matching. The kicker was that with DNA-matched cars, owners would be able to start their Lexuses by licking the steering wheel.3) McLaren Automotive McLaren said it's boosting efficiency by quite eccentric measures, such as measuring the technology center's lake and floor tiles daily, and by synchronizing the staff's tea breaks.4) BMW Motorrad BMW's motorcycle arm is solving parts availability issues in remote locations by offering a 3D printer mounted permanently on the bike's rack: If you need to replace a broken-off gear lever, you can just print one. "The new system will mean that even very rarely required parts not generally stocked by BMW Motorrad sales partners can be supplied on a just-in-time basis." BMW even went to the lengths of announcing that the "BMW Motorrad iPart 3D Mobile Printer" was tested on the Antarctic, by erecting a tent whose poles were produced onsite.5) Honda Last but not least, Honda UK purportedly cut the roof off a new CR-V, calling it the CR-V Roadster. Tellingly, no convertible top was even offered for the concept, "making it a no-top rather than a drop-top. Porsche Cayman GT4 spotted at the N?rburgring

Tue, 13 May 2014

It was just the other day that we first caught wind of Porsche's plans to build a GT4 version of the Cayman, and now we're already looking at spy shots of the vehicle in question undergoing testing at - where else? - the Nürburgring.
With more aggressive front-end aero, a GT3-style air vent ahead of the front hood, a large wing at the back, and spindly alloys packed with over-sized brakes at each corner, this Cayman is clearly more extreme than even the range-topping GTS. The rear diffuser and central exhaust tips look about the same as those you'd find at the back of the Cayman GTS, though.
What we can't see, of course, is what Porsche has slotted in under the rear glass, how it's upgraded the interior and how much weight it's stripped out of the thing to get it down to fighting weight, but you can bet it'll come with a substantial power bump and a stripped-out interior with racing buckets and little else to open the gap between it and the GTS... and close the gap to the 911 GT3 which it will join as the baby brother in Porsche's performance-focused lineup. Jay Leno takes an in-depth look at a 1964 Porsche 356C restomod

Tue, Oct 13 2015

Look nearly anywhere at Dr. Anand Rajani's 1964 Porsche 356C, even the engine, and you would never realize that it boasts around 50 percent more power than stock. There's no sign of any other mods to make the drive a bit more modern, either, but they're there. The car's invisible upgrades result in an amazing transformation of a car that started out pretty great to begin with, and Jay Leno can't seem to get enough of driving this beautiful, gray coupe with restorer John Willhoit. Before going for a drive, Leno takes a deep dive into the details of this Porsche's modifications, particularly of its engine. The result of all the work is a mill that looks visually stock but actually boasts a significant jump in displacement. Willhoit admits this is particular one is a fairly conservative build but output still reaches 145 horsepower and 145 pound-feet of torque.
